Mastering the Best Gas and Pellet Grill Combo

Versatile cooking power

The true strength of a unit mastering both grilling and smoking lies in its inherent adaptability.

This dual-fuel advantage means you can execute a wider array of culinary techniques, moving effortlessly from searing steaks with intense, direct heat to slow-cooking tender pulled pork with smoky, low-temperature precision. It provides the best of both worlds, allowing for distinct cooking styles on a single appliance.

Whether it’s achieving a perfect char on burgers or imparting a rich, wood-fired flavor to ribs, this flexibility significantly enhances your outdoor cooking repertoire.

Crucially, achieving these diverse results depends on independent temperature control for each fuel source. This allows you to manage the gas for quick searing and the pellet system for consistent smoke and lower temperatures simultaneously, without interference. Imagine hot-and-fast grilling on one side while maintaining a steady 225°F for smoking on the other – this level of control ensures optimal results for any dish, eliminating the need for multiple cooking devices and maximizing your culinary possibilities.

Temperature precision and control

Achieving consistent and accurate cooking temperatures is paramount for culinary success, especially when harnessing the dual power of gas and pellet grilling.

This factor dictates the difference between perfectly seared steaks and dried-out chicken, or delicately smoked ribs and burnt offerings. Understanding how your unit manages heat is key to unlocking its full potential for diverse cooking techniques.

Consider the pellet hopper’s capacity; a larger hopper means fewer interruptions for fueling during long smokes. Similarly, efficient fuel management within the pellet system ensures stable temperatures.

Modern units often feature digital controllers that offer remarkable precision, allowing you to set exact temperatures and monitor them with digital readouts, which can be a significant upgrade over the less exact nature of manual knobs, especially for temperature-sensitive recipes like delicate fish or low-and-slow barbecue.

Frequently Asked Questions

What’S The Main Advantage Of A Gas And Pellet Grill Combo?

A combo grill offers the best of both worlds: the quick searing power of gas and the smoky flavor infusion of pellets.

Can I Smoke Meat On The Gas Side And Grill On The Pellet Side?

Typically, you’ll use the pellet side for smoking and the gas side for direct grilling, though some models offer more flexibility.

How Does Temperature Control Differ Between The Two Sides?

Gas grills usually have burner knobs, while pellet grills often use digital controllers for precise temperature management.

Are Gas And Pellet Grills Harder To Clean Than Traditional Grills?

They can be slightly more involved due to the pellet hopper and ash, but many models are designed for easy cleaning.
